I have questions about the 3 very popular belted magnums that most guys seem to have up my way. As I am just a rimmed cartridge shooter I am not totally sure about these.
Now the 300 Win. mag is a bigger case than the 7mm Rem mag and 338 Win mag(these are basically the same case with different neck sizes)
It seems to me a heavy load in the 300WM and a 220gr bullet would be slightly superior to a 338WM loaded with a 200gr bullet. True? I would think the 338 would really start to shine with bullets in the 250gr range. But why did Winchester not just neck up the 300WM to get the 338WM? I assume the 338 came out first.
Now the 7mmRM due to the small bore cannot be compared as well, but is normally loaded with bullets in the 160gr range from what I have seen.
Most shooters have moderate loads in the 3 magnums and medium weight bullets which makes me wonder why not just get a 30-06?
